Though Jaroslav Rossler (1902-1990) is one of the most important Czech avant-garde photographers, and his work from the 1920s ranks among the earliest and most radical examples of the application of principles of abstract art and Constructivism to photography, this long-awaited book is the first monograph ever on Rossler's life and art.
